54.52286, -5.68886The Old Schoolhouse Inn Comber is located about a 10-minute drive from Nendrum Monastic Site, offering 14 rooms along with a sundeck, a sun terrace, and a picnic area.
Location
You'll need 22-minute drive to George Best Belfast City airport. WWT Castle Espie Wetland Centre can be found just a short stroll from this 4-star inn. Take benefit from the proximity to WWT Castle Espie, which is just 0.7 miles away.
